Statements, which might contain sensitive user-generated data.Īll rows in SVV_TRANSACTIONS are visible to all users. STL_QUERYTEXT contain the full text of INSERT, UPDATE, and DELETE Visibility to data generated by other users. Substitute and for your corresponding values.Giving a user unrestricted access to system tables gives the user Not all of them work (they are the result of running SQL Data Compare) and I want to group them in some transactions and roll back the statements if something goes wrong. How often do CVRP program requirements change CVRPs Terms and Conditions and Implementation Manual. ,'-DROP VIEW ' tgtnsp.nspname '.' tgtobj.relname ' \nCREATE OR REPLACE VIEW ' tgtnsp.nspname '.' tgtobj.relname ' AS\n' COALESCE(pg_get_viewdef(tgtobj.oid, TRUE), '') AS ddl 22 I have some ALTER TABLE statements that I am running. This means that if your schema modification takes a long time, the table. You must also have the ALTER and DROP privileges on the original table, and the CREATE and INSERT privileges on the new table. Both AWS Redshift and Azure Synapse support SQL ALTER TABLE commands that allow. When you execute RENAME, you cannot have any locked tables or active transactions. The operations include resizing, pausing, resuming, renaming, and deleting. looks much worst then it accurately is because off the. Specify RENAME TO newname to rename the trigger. AWS Documentation Amazon Redshift Management Guide Overview of managing clusters in Amazon Redshift PDF RSS After your cluster is created, there are several operations you can perform on it. You can also use the DISABLE ALL TRIGGERS clause of ALTER TABLE to disable all triggers associated with a table. The following SQL would show all the dependent views for a particular table and produce to re-create each corresponding view. How do you stop a trigger in Oracle Specify DISABLE to disable the trigger. You can easily obtain the DDL for the views before changing the name, and you can re-run the DDL when you are ready, so your views would point the the right place. There is nothing you can do either on your "ALTER TABLE" statement or "CREATE VIEW" statement that would prevent a dependent view from being changed when the underlying table changes. The following command renames the USERS table to USERSBKUP. There is NOT a way to prevent this behavior in Redshift. The following examples demonstrate basic usage of the ALTER TABLE command. The short answer to your question is "NO". The feature that you are searching would be very useful when you are manually doing table maintenance and you want to move/create/rename tables without impacting existing dependent objects.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|